Trabalhando com arrays no php

Como podemos criar array no php, bom para alguns que está começando deve pensar que é um bicho de 7 cabeças, mas na verdade não é nada disso, é algo bem simples, então vamos ver um exemplo explicando passo a passo.

Primeiro vou mostrar um array simples usando php , veja abaixo o exemplo :

$Usuario = array('Tutorial Chefe','tutorialchefe@blogspot.com','123456');

Entendendo o array :

Veja que na variavel $Usuario atibui 3 valores no array, sem nenhum indice, pois o array ele automaticamente ja tem essas indices que começa sempre do zero.

Então com nosso array acima podemos exibir ele na tela usando o Echo , veja abaixo :

Exemplo 1 :

echo $Usuario[0]; // retorna o nome que no caso é Tutorial Chefe
echo $Usuario[1]; // retorna o email 
echo $Usuario[2]; // retorna a senha que é 123456


Como você pode ver é algo muito simples de se usar, vamos ver mais um exemplo atribuindo indice e valor , para isso vou usar o mesmo array do começo.

Array com chave e valor :

Exemplo 2 :

$Usuario = array(
'nome'=>'Tutorial Chefe',
'email'=>'tutorialchefe@blogspot.com',
'senha'=>'123456'
);

Como visto acima definimos novos indices para cada valor , veja agora como podemos exibir estes valores :

echo $Usuario['nome'];
echo $Usuario['email'];
echo $Usuario['senha'];

O resultado sera :

Tutorial Chefe tutorialchefe@blogspot.com 123456

Podemos criar também arrays somente usando apenas a variavel, para isso vou mudar um pouco os valores, veja abaixo o exemplo :

Exemplo 3 :

$Usuario['nome'] = 'Marcos';
$Usuario['email'] = 'marcos@marcos.com';
$Usuario['senha'] = '123456';

Podemos exibir os resultados da mesma forma do exemplo 2, veja abaixo :

echo $Usuario['nome'];
echo $Usuario['email'];
echo $Usuario['senha'];

O resultado sera :

Marcos marcos@marcos.com 123456

Bom pessoal é isso poderia ter mostrado mais mas pra quem está começando ja é uma ajuda , então espero que vocês tenha gostado dos exemplos e dicas, tentei fazer os exemplos assim você tera um noção bem melhor e mais pratico. :)
Previous
Next Post »